Forming is the first stage that starts with everyone not really knowing each other and everyone is very polite. There is a lack of trust during this stage because of people not knowing one another.

WebApr 13, 2024 · Norming is the stage when group members start to resolve their differences, accept each other, and cooperate more effectively.
